Default Southport National 18th and 19th July 2009

Some Information If You are attending the Southport National

The Cafe is Open:- from about 7:00 'til around 6:00pm serving hot food and drinks as well as a few sweets and cans of pop. There will the usual "stand pipe" arrangement for cold water throughout the weekend

Toilets:- as usual the clubhouse toilet facilities will be available from around 6:30am through to around 9:00pm, thereafter there will be toilets outside the clubhouse.

Speed Limit:- for real cars across the field is 2mph

Entrances to the park:- There are 2 ways directly into the park. do not use the entrance near the boating lake that takes you past the childrens playground. The entrance to the park is the "middle" one by the garden centre. However if it is very wet, then this entrance becomes waterlogged so please be careful - we will have measures in place to (hopefully) cope with this eventuality.

Directions to Victoria Park
From the North: - Exit M6 at Junction 26 joining the M58 west until Junction 1(switch island) Carry straight on the A5036 following Brown Information Signs for Southport Tourist until the first set of traffic lights (Police Station & Travel Inn on right) Turn right (sign posted Formby) A5207 North Perimeter Road. Straight on at Lights into Lydiate Lane (A5207) at next set of lights turn right (sign posted Southport) A565. Keep on A565 (Formby Bypass) for Approx. 6 miles, after passing RAF Woodvale Airfield on the left take the next left at the traffic lights (Coastal Road). At the Second Island take the third exit onto Weld Road then first left onto Rotten Row. Entrance to the track is 100 yards on left

Sat Nav:- Rotten Row, PR8 2BZ

The Track:- has seen some big changes over the past few weeks - the biggest change is the new astro turf sections that have replaced the grass....it's the same astro as we have on the straight and it is very very grippy.

Caravans:- There are still some Caravan spaces left, if you want them please PM me on here for my address details. Please note that if you bring a campervan onto the park, you still have to pay the £10.00 camping fee and bring a copy of your insurance for our records. Please be aware this condition is imposed by the Council not the Club...

Victoria Park:- will be open from 2:00pm on Friday 17th July. There will be no admission to the Park before then for caravans/tents/pit tents etc.

The Weather:- has been booked, we requested glorious sunshine....

Litter:- There will be plenty of bins around the site and a skip too....please use them!
